On Sunday evening Aug. 3, at 6:11 p.m., the Le Mars Fire-Rescue Department was called to 16123 Hickory Avenue for a house fire. This was about 11 miles west and north of Le Mars.

The SDFA has had several inquiries about phone calls soliciting for various firefighter organizations. The SDFA does not have companies call for funds, ever.
